American alligator/aligátor americano
Gator or common alligator, is a large crocodilian reptile endemic to the Southeastern United States. It is larger than the only other living alligator species, the Chinese alligator. Adult male American alligators measure to 4.6 m ( to 15.1 ft) in length, and can weigh up to 453 kg (999 lb). Females are smaller, measuring to 3 m (to 9.8 ft) in length.
